Hi, El Perrito, I have stayed in the resorts of Cala d'Or and Alcudia. Cala d'Or is a beautiful place with a hippodrome, marina and so many seafood resturants to choose from. There are several beaches, weather permitting, and glass bottomed boat trips around the bay. This could be said to be a millionaires paradise. The boats in the marina are luxurious and you will see many a Rolls Royce or Harley Davidson parked nearby.
Alcudia has a beautiful expanse of beach and here you will find all kinds of nightlife. The Old Town has a weekly market and roman walls and ruins to see.

I have spent a couple of holidays in Malloraca.
Pouerto Pollensa is a great quiet location with good beach and nice restaurants. Away from the crowds.Good walks from the town accross the peninsula to next beach through mountains. Plenty of bird life if thats your thing.
Pollensa town in land about 5 km has a good walk up steps and overlooks whole area.
Definite must see.
The inland mountainous area is worth a visit.

Hi all.... Breif resume of last week.

Arrived at Palma around noon on sat 27th. Bus to Palma touristoffice at 1.30. Lunch at plaza d Espana. Hotell fixed at 3. Afternoon spent walking in Palma. Dinner at el Pilon (excellent), and so the week went on. Excellent ! Not one single "deseastre".

Weather was great (one day of rain only) not many tourists, trips to Soller and it's Puerto, Banyalbufar, Valledemossa, Alcudia, Pollenca, el Faro of colmar.... or something. Shopping, Golfing (my friend not me), "beach-jogging" and so it went on.

Yes you can have an excellent vacation in Palma in October.

Fun things (highlights): Boatwatching (including Clintons trip from Palma). Security at Israel and Palestine summit (never seen som many Guardia Civiles with cars, boats, choppers, you name it.)

Dia de los santos : 1. Check out the Brittons at Escape Bar in Palma (party hearty) 2. They had to call in the local police to direct the traffic around the Palma cementery (which in itself is woth a visit, huge).

Apart from El Pilon a great restaurant that has a striking resemblance wiht Casa Mingo in Madrid (see string above), I have forgot the name though.

Nightlife, like always in Spain, fabulous.

Swimming nude outside Banyalbufar.

Palmanova, Hotel called Mimosa Palace(we returned to the scene of the crime 15 years later, what memories).

Leave alone : Tourist settlements and Urbanisaciones (Palmanova, Magaluf, Sta Ponca). La Loncha in Palma. I you have seen Catedrales, Castillos, Murallas e.t.c Mallorca has nothing new to offer. Valdemossa, full of tourists even this time of year.
